US workers wages collapse, people will now accept less for work. The NY Times is reporting that there is a housing crisis in Silicon Valley. Chicago's national activity index went to zero unexpectedly.

Mnuchin visited Fort Knox and lets the people know that the gold is safe without showing any proof. Norway government is purchasing more global stocks with the idea that the returns will help the government. China is now pulling investment dollars from the West and redirecting to the east.
